It constructs underground dens with hinged, trap-door like operculum made of sand and glue, in order to disguise the entrance from predators.The Sands of Samar, the last remaining sand dunes in the southern Arava region of Israel and home to C. aravaensis, are disappearing. The species was first described by Gorshom Levy of the Hebrew University of Jerusalem in 2007, though news agencies later reported it in 2010 as a new discovery (with a slightly different spelling) by a team of biologists from the University of Haifa.
